On Saturday, Mumbai woke up to welcome its coolest, newest and one of the best sound studios – Orbis! A lavish Open House was hosted at this Khar studio to announce its opening. Celebrity well-wishers such as Rajkumar Hirani, Shaan, Kunal Ganjawala, with singer-wife Gayatri Iyer, Ila Arun and daughter Ishita Arun, musicians Uday Mazumdar and Rajat Dholakia and cinematographer Kiran Deohans came to wish luck and success to the partners Bishwadeep Chatterjee and Abhishek Pandey. It was a stylish do where refreshing mocktails flowed, exquisite gourmet food was served in wooden platters and petite cupcakes were dolloped down by the guests.
Many guests who came in were pleasantly surprised at the thought that was given to every small detail – from the equipment set-up to the private space for sitting back and thinking. Says Bishwadeep Chatterjee, who is the sound designer of films such as 3 Idiots, the Munnabhai series, Devdas, Vicky Donor, etc, “I have worked in hundreds of studios in the past 25 years. I knew exactly what to keep and what to totally avoid. Acoustically, I am proud to say that Orbis is one of the best that you can get in the city. Our aim is to never compromise on quality and deliver beyond the client’s expectations.” Adds Abhishek, “We wanted to create a space that’s both, technologically better than most in the business and aesthetically tasteful. Orbis is everything I would want in a sound studio – technically excellent, bright, colourful, quiet, personal and a place that lets me ideate. We slogged for months and the way everything has shaped up, it has exceeded even our expectations!”
The celebrations that began in the morning went on till way past midnight, with well-wishers pouring-in in large numbers to see the studio. If this was any indication of the journey ahead, Orbis is headed towards scaling great heights! Here’s wishing them all the success!
